家の近所に沸いたカビゴンを探しきれなかった反省から、ポケモンGOの「かくれているポケモン(旧:近くにいるポケモン)」を確実に探すためのツールを作った。
わかっていること†
- 隠れているポケモンに表示されいる場合、半径200m以内にいる
- 隠れているポケモンに表示されない場合、半径200m以内にいない
- 複数の居る範囲と居ない範囲をANDとNOTで集合演算(ブーリアン演算)すれば、探す範囲を絞り込めるのでは?
家の近所で実施テストした†
ポケモンがいることに気がついて(1枚目)、範囲円を描画(2枚目)。少し南に歩くとポケモンが消えたので、居ない範囲をNOTとして削り(3枚目)、絞り込んだ三日月型の範囲の下側に移動しながらさらに範囲を絞り込んだ(4枚目)、最終的に絞り込んだ位置に移動すると、ポケモンを確認できた(5枚目)。
作ったツール†
https://ss1.xrea.com/reddog.s35.xrea.com/PokemonBooleanSearch/
ツールの説明†
- ポケモンがいるときは「In」ボタンを押す
- ポケモンがいないときは「Out」ボタンを押す
- 直前の操作を取り消すときは「Undo」ボタンを押す
- GPSが捕捉できないときは大阪城がデフォ
- iPhone5sのみでテスト
- Android端末、ちゃんと動くか不明
- Android端末、GPS精度落ちるやつもあるかも?
- ホーム画面に追加して画面を広く使うこともできるけど、Safariで使ったほうが速いみたい
コメントをどーぞ†
- 役に立ちました!このツールで地図読み感覚を鍛えて、自分で見つけられるようにもなりたいです! -- kitei
- androidでは標準のchromeではgpsが有効にならないけど、別のブラウザならok。例えばOperaMini。あとは表示されてる地図が好きなurlに出来ると完璧ですな。 -- t-jin
- ChromeだとHTTPSでないとGPS使えませんでしたね・・・ツールのリンク先をHTTPSに変更しましたのでAndroidでも使えるかと。 -- reddog
CategoryJavaScript